Historical & Cultural Background
In Sanskrit, 'Dharma' is a key concept in Hinduism and Buddhism, representing law, duty, and righteousness. It plays a significant role in the moral and ethical framework of these religions. In Indonesian culture, the name reflects a sense of existence and being, often associated with spiritual or philosophical meanings.
